CITIC Offshore Helicopter Co., Ltd. - PESTLE Analysis: Political factors
The stability of the Chinese government is a crucial factor for CITIC Offshore Helicopter Co., Ltd. (COHC). As of October 2023, China has maintained a stable political environment under the leadership of the Communist Party. According to the World Bank, China's governance indicator for political stability and absence of violence is at **0.75**, indicating a relatively stable environment for business operations.
Regulatory policies also play a vital role in the aviation sector, particularly regarding safety. The Civil Aviation Administration of China (CAAC) oversees aviation safety regulations. In recent years, the CAAC has adopted new regulations aimed at enhancing safety standards, including stricter requirements for pilot training and aircraft maintenance. In 2022, the CAAC reported that the overall accident rate in Chinese aviation fell to **0.17 accidents per 100,000 flight hours**, underscoring the impact of these regulations on improving safety.
International relations significantly influence COHC's offshore operations. The company's activities are closely linked to the geopolitical climate, especially in the South China Sea. The ongoing territorial disputes and tensions with neighboring countries could potentially disrupt operations. For instance, in 2022, China escalated its military presence in the South China Sea, leading to increased scrutiny and challenges for companies operating in these regions.
Trade agreements also affect CITIC Offshore Helicopter's operations. China is part of several key trade agreements, including the Regional Comprehensive Economic Partnership (RCEP), which came into effect in January 2022. This agreement aims to enhance trade facilitation and may positively impact the supply chain for COHC, reducing costs and improving efficiency in the procurement of helicopter parts and services.
The political support for energy sector investment is another factor that significantly benefits COHC. The Chinese government has prioritized the energy sector, particularly offshore oil and gas exploration. As per China's 14th Five-Year Plan, approved in March 2021, the government aims to increase offshore oil production by **7%** annually through 2025. This political backing creates a favorable business environment for companies like COHC that provide transportation services to offshore energy projects.

CITIC Offshore Helicopter Co., Ltd. - PESTLE Analysis: Economic factors
The economic health of CITIC Offshore Helicopter Co., Ltd. is significantly influenced by various factors impacting the aviation and energy industries.
Fluctuations in global oil prices
Global oil prices directly affect the demand for offshore helicopter services. In 2022, Brent crude oil averaged approximately $100 per barrel, up from around $71 in 2021. As of mid-2023, prices have fluctuated around $83 to $90 per barrel. Increased oil prices often lead to more offshore drilling activities, which can boost demand for helicopter services.
Economic growth in target markets
The economic growth rate in target markets, particularly in China, plays a pivotal role in the company's performance. In 2023, China's GDP growth rate is projected at 5.5%, reflecting a rebound from the previous years impacted by the pandemic. Other target regions, such as Southeast Asia, are experiencing growth rates between 4% to 6%, creating potential demand for CITIC's services in offshore logistics and transportation.
Currency exchange rate volatility
CITIC Offshore Helicopter Co., Ltd. operates in an international environment where currency fluctuations can impact profitability. As of October 2023, the CNY/USD exchange rate stands at approximately 0.14, showing a depreciation from 0.15 in 2021. This depreciation affects operational costs and revenue repatriation, given that equipment and maintenance may often be billed in different currencies.
Costs associated with maintenance and fuel
Increased global energy prices have led to rising operational costs for helicopter services. In 2022, maintenance costs for helicopters were estimated to be around $1.2 million annually per aircraft. Fuel costs for offshore helicopter operations have risen significantly, with average fuel prices at about $3.50 per gallon, compared to $2.50 per gallon in 2021, representing a 40% increase.
Investment in offshore infrastructure
Investment in offshore infrastructure remains crucial for the growth of helicopter services. In 2023, global investments in offshore oil and gas infrastructure are projected to reach $254 billion, indicating a significant market opportunity. The Chinese government continues to support the development of offshore energy projects, committing approximately $30 billion over the next five years to enhance related infrastructure, which in turn benefits companies like CITIC.

CITIC Offshore Helicopter Co., Ltd. - PESTLE Analysis: Social factors
CITIC Offshore Helicopter Co., Ltd. operates in a specialized sector heavily influenced by various sociological factors. Understanding these factors is critical for assessing the company's operational environment.
Workforce skill levels in the aviation sector
The aviation sector, particularly in helicopter services, demands highly skilled personnel. According to the International Air Transport Association (IATA), the global aviation industry requires about 1.3 million new pilots and around 1.9 million new technicians by 2036. In China, the demand for helicopter pilots has significantly increased, with an estimated need for approximately 5,000 helicopter pilots by 2025.
Community support for energy projects
Community backing is crucial for the success of energy projects, especially in offshore operations. In 2023, over 70% of communities near offshore wind farms expressed support for these projects, according to a report by the Global Wind Energy Council (GWEC). CITIC Offshore Helicopter plays a vital role in supporting these energy projects through transportation services.
Employee safety and welfare standards
Safety standards in the aviation sector are paramount. According to data from the International Civil Aviation Organization (ICAO), the helicopter accident rate was recorded at 0.79 accidents per 100,000 flight hours in 2022. CITIC Offshore Helicopter adheres to strict safety protocols, with an investment of approximately $10 million annually in training and safety equipment to ensure employee welfare.
Public perception of helicopter services
Public perception can significantly impact the demand for helicopter services. A survey conducted by Market Research Future in 2023 revealed that 65% of respondents viewed helicopter transportation as safe and efficient, driving demand for services in the energy sector. However, only 40% of the respondents had experience using helicopter services, indicating a gap in confidence that could be addressed through awareness campaigns.
Demographic changes affecting labor supply
Demographic shifts are influencing the labor supply in the aviation sector. As of 2023, the average age of helicopter pilots is approximately 45 years. With an impending retirement wave, it is estimated that around 35% of current pilots will retire within the next decade. This presents a significant challenge for companies like CITIC Offshore Helicopter to attract younger talent into the industry.

CITIC Offshore Helicopter Co., Ltd. - PESTLE Analysis: Technological factors
CITIC Offshore Helicopter Co., Ltd. (COHC) operates in a rapidly evolving technological landscape, particularly in the aviation and offshore oil and gas industries. The following elements highlight significant technological factors influencing the company's operations.
Advancements in helicopter technology
As of 2023, COHC has invested significantly in upgrading its fleet with modern helicopters which include the Eurocopter EC225 and AgustaWestland AW189. These models feature enhanced payload capacities, with the EC225 capable of carrying up to 24 passengers and a maximum takeoff weight of approximately 11,000 kg. Recent reports indicate that the market for advanced helicopters is projected to grow at a CAGR of 4.5% from 2022 to 2029.
Integration of digital navigation systems
The integration of digital navigation systems in COHC's fleet has shown to enhance operational efficiency. The company has implemented systems such as Global Positioning System (GPS) and Advanced Cockpit Management Systems which have improved navigation accuracy by 30%, reducing flight time and fuel consumption by around 15%.
Development of safety technologies
Safety is paramount in helicopter operations. COHC has adopted advanced safety technologies such as Terrain Awareness and Warning Systems (TAWS) and Automatic Dependent Surveillance-Broadcast (ADS-B). These technologies have contributed to a decrease in accident rates by 25% over the past five years. Furthermore, the investment in maintenance technologies has reduced unplanned maintenance events by 20%.
Competition in technological innovation
The competitive landscape in the helicopter service sector requires constant innovation. Major competitors, such as Bristow Group and Heli-One, have also made strides in technology. Bristow has implemented the Fly-by-Wire systems across its fleet which offers enhanced control and efficiency, further emphasizing the importance of technological advancements in maintaining market competitiveness.
Investment in R&D for efficiency
Research and Development (R&D) are critical for COHC’s technological edge. In 2023, the company allocated approximately 10% of its annual revenue—around ¥1.2 billion—towards R&D initiatives aimed at improving fuel efficiency and reducing emissions. The R&D efforts have led to innovations that decrease fuel consumption by 10%-15% per flight hour, aligning with global trends towards sustainability in aviation.

CITIC Offshore Helicopter Co., Ltd. - PESTLE Analysis: Legal factors
The legal framework governing CITIC Offshore Helicopter Co., Ltd. is shaped by multiple factors that directly influence its operations.
Compliance with aviation regulations
CITIC Offshore Helicopter is required to adhere to strict aviation regulations set forth by the Civil Aviation Administration of China (CAAC). The company holds several certifications crucial for its operations, including the Air Operator Certificate (AOC), which was last issued in 2020. Additionally, compliance with international standards such as the International Civil Aviation Organization (ICAO) is mandatory for maintaining operational integrity in international waters.
International maritime law impact
As a company operating in offshore environments, CITIC Offshore Helicopter is subject to international maritime laws, including the United Nations Convention on the Law of the Sea (UNCLOS). The company must comply with regulations regarding safety, environmental standards, and navigational rights, particularly when operating in exclusive economic zones (EEZs) of various countries. In 2023, regulatory compliance costs accounted for approximately 15% of total operational expenditures.
Labor laws affecting operational staff
The workforce of CITIC Offshore Helicopter is governed by a variety of labor laws that mandate working conditions, employee rights, and compensation. For instance, in accordance with China’s Labor Contract Law, employees must be salaried appropriately, with an average salary for helicopter pilots reported at RMB 300,000 per annum. Labor disputes can have significant operational impacts; in 2022, the company reported a 10% increase in labor-related legal disputes, leading to additional legal expenses.
Intellectual property rights for technology
CITIC Offshore Helicopter invests heavily in proprietary technology for its helicopter services. Intellectual property (IP) rights are crucial to safeguarding innovations, particularly in avionics systems and operational software. The company has filed over 50 patents in the last five years related to improvements in safety protocols and fuel efficiency. In 2021 alone, legal costs associated with IP protection amounted to RMB 5 million.
Contractual agreements with partners
The company engages in various contractual agreements for services and partnerships, often involving joint ventures and service contracts. As of 2023, CITIC Offshore Helicopter has engaged in over 20 active contracts with foreign entities under joint operating agreements, significantly diversifying its operational portfolio. These contracts typically include clauses related to liability, service duration, and compliance with local laws, with an average contract value of RMB 50 million.

CITIC Offshore Helicopter Co., Ltd. - PESTLE Analysis: Environmental factors
The aviation industry is increasingly influenced by stringent emission regulations. In China, for instance, the government aims for a carbon peak by 2030 and carbon neutrality by 2060, impacting aviation operations. The Civil Aviation Administration of China (CAAC) has introduced regulations that require airlines and operators to monitor and report greenhouse gas emissions, including CO2. Compliance with these regulations is becoming critical for CITIC Offshore Helicopter Co., Ltd. to ensure operational sustainability.
The impact of operations on marine ecosystems is significant, particularly for helicopter operations in offshore oil and gas exploration. Helicopter flights can disrupt wildlife, especially in sensitive areas. Studies indicate that noise pollution from helicopter operations can affect marine species, which are vulnerable to disturbances. Research shows that marine mammals such as dolphins have shown altered behavioral patterns when exposed to noise levels above 120 dB. CITIC’s operational zones often overlap with critical habitats, necessitating careful planning to mitigate these impacts.
In recent years, the adoption of greener technologies has gained traction in the aviation sector. CITIC Offshore Helicopter has been actively pursuing partnerships for innovative technology. For instance, the company has explored the integration of biofuels into their fleet operations. The usage of sustainable aviation fuels (SAF) can reduce lifecycle emissions by up to 80%. More than 1 billion liters of SAF are anticipated to be produced annually by the end of 2025, with increased demand expected from operators focused on sustainability.
Environmental assessments for projects are now mandatory under international and national regulations. CITIC is required to conduct thorough environmental impact assessments (EIA) before commencing operations, especially in ecologically sensitive areas. Data from 2021 indicated that projects with comprehensive EIAs saw a 25% reduction in project delays due to environmental concerns. These assessments not only ensure compliance but also contribute to corporate social responsibility (CSR) initiatives.
Climate change poses direct challenges to operational conditions. Rising sea levels and increased frequency of extreme weather events can affect offshore platforms and the logistics of helicopter operations. A recent report indicated that the frequency of severe storms in the South China Sea has increased by 40% over the last decade. This trend necessitates advanced risk management strategies and adaptive operational protocols for CITIC Offshore Helicopter to maintain safety and efficiency.
